Miniature Sculptures for YouOn top of an isolated mountain in extreme western North Carolina, a very talented artist works to create miniature sculptures that you can wear. In fact, he is so isolated he was surprised by a bear visiting not long ago! Over many years, he has carefully observed a variety of wildlife, drawn them, painted them, and attempted to capture the feeling each creature inspired in him. Then, he carved many wood, clay, and wax figures until he arrived at a particular design that expressed his feeling for a particular animal. This design was then refined and recarved until a suitable wax sculpture was created. From that wax master, the final pieces were cast in sterling silver and fine pewter. Over the years, Arch has developed over 100 different designs, including a few that were customized to the point of becoming a custom-made, one-of-a-kind item. Several of his designs have been discontinued, and since they're no longer available, they've become collectible.
